Advances in online education for diabetes

In the field of diabetes, self -control education is a fundamental pillar to achieve good glycemic control and avoid complications.Traditionally, this training has been taught in person, but the digital era opens the doors to online education, an increasingly viable and promising option.

Online education stands out for its flexibility, allowing patients to learn both synchronically and asynchronously, adapting to their schedules and needs.This modality is especially beneficial for those with mobility difficulties or residing in remote areas, facilitating access to educational resources without the physical barriers of traditional education.In addition, it represents a significant cost reduction, both for patients and for health systems.

A recent study carried out by nurses specialized in diabetes in Spain has yielded revealing results.In people with type 1 diabetes, online education has proven to be as effective as the face -to -face in the control of HBA1C.However, in the case of type 2 diabetes, the online modality not only matches, but exceeds the face -to -face, offering a remarkable improvement in reducing HBA1C levels.

Beyond biomedical markers, online education has shown a positive impact on patient's quality of life, underlining their profitability and convenience.The possibility of accessing education flexibly contributes significantly to general well -being, a critical aspect for long -term management of diabetes.

Despite its multiple advantages, online education does not seek to completely replace the face -to -face, but act as a complement.The combination of both methodologies can provide a more complete and accessible educational experience.

The integration of online education in diabetes management represents a significant advance, offering an effective and flexible alternative that can improve health results.The key is to find the appropriate balance and use both approaches in a complementary way, thus maximizing the benefits for patients.

Online education for diabetes is not only an emerging trend, but a reality with considerable potential to transform the lives of those who live with this condition.Its implementation and continuous development promise a future where education is more accessible, personalized and effective.
